00:00so if you're one of those golfers that really struggles with releasing the club actually how
00:12how you strike the ball when you're doing these kind of short chip shots I've got a great little
00:17drill to just to give you the understanding of how the club passes the body now what we see we
00:22see two types of poor release patterns when when we're talking about these kind of short shots the
00:27first one is we've been told at some point that we don't want to use too much risk so what we tend
00:33to do is get very wooden very kind of stiff with our whole upper body and our arms and we actually
00:40try and then hold the club off this is what we call a block release the opposite can happen when we get
00:45too kind of wristy and actually we get this kind of what we call this open sort of early kind of
00:52release pattern here where we actually return the club at the wrong kind of the wrong way so the
00:58drill looks like this what I want you to do is take your left hand off and just place it onto your
01:02lead thigh and I just want you to grip the club as you would normally with your with your trail arm
01:07and I want you to feel like it's really nice and soft and you're just going to practice making some
01:12swings where the club comes up going to let it just naturally drop let gravity do its thing and actually
01:18just get used to brushing the ground you can see the club is now releasing past my body it's exposing
01:24the bounce if I do it on the ball just as a practice it's here let it drop and let it naturally
01:30kind of release if I then take another normal shot put my hands back on a nice way to just transition
01:37from this is then just with your lead arm just try and do exactly the same thing but let's just grip
01:42this nice and lightly to start with just do a couple of practice swings let the club drop
01:47let it pass go past your body and then let's just try and do one onto the ball
01:52that's a great way to give you the understanding of how to the club releases past your body stops
02:00you thinning it stops you hitting all those terrible shots and start enjoying some good chips so this is

03:06that circle so if you're one of those golfers that really struggles to make a good strike one of the
03:12things that could be happening is you're decelerating the club throughout the downswing
03:17now one of the things that I see a lot of sort of higher handicappers do they take the club so far
03:22back for such a short shot the brain is very good at kind of making its own kind of calibration
03:28and it kind of just goes well if I make a normal swing and I flush it I'm just going to nut it over
03:33the back so what will that what they do is they then naturally start to slow down unfortunately what
03:38then happens is the club is then decelerating to the point of when it strikes what really good
03:45chippers do is the complete opposite the club is actually accelerating past the ball so the fastest
03:50point of the swing is just past the golf ball so one of the really nice drills that I like to practice
03:55I've just got six balls here at the green and all I'm going to try and do is take a nicer kind of
04:00shorter backswing back I'm going to feel like I'm accelerating through I'm going to do a slightly longer
04:06finish so it's not going to be too far back nice and short longer finish through the whole idea with
04:13this is the club is accelerating towards the target now one of the problems that some people do when
04:18they try this for the first time is actually they go really too short and they sort of stab at it I
04:24still want you to keep your nice tempo your nice rhythm let that club fall but always make sure
04:30you're accelerating through to the target so this is a nice little drill just to give you a good kind
